diff --git a/modules/caravan/module.go b/modules/caravan/module.go index f06b0ac35..f8b01f115 100644 --- a/modules/caravan/module.go +++ b/modules/caravan/module.go @@ -238,6 +238,14 @@ func (this *Caravan) CheckCaravanTask(session comm.IUserSession, data *pb.DBCara } this.CleanCaravanTask(session.GetUserId(), data) //任务超时 清理任务数据 + data.Eventid = 0 + data.Tasktime = 0 + data.Eventid = 0 + update := make(map[string]interface{}) + update["eventid"] = data.Eventid + update["tasktime"] = data.Tasktime + update["eventid"] = data.Eventid + this.modelCaravan.modifyCaravanDataByObjId(session.GetUserId(), update) // 任务超时发送任务失败推送 resp := &pb.CaravanTaskCompletePush{} resp.Data = data